    Cost of Golf Lessons in San Diego

    The cost of golf lessons in San Diego can vary depending on the instructor’s experience, the type of lesson, and the location. Private lessons typically range from $75 to $200 per hour, while group lessons and clinics are generally more affordable. Some instructors also offer package deals or discounts for multiple lessons.

    Tacos: A San Diego Staple

    San Diego’s proximity to Mexico means incredible and affordable tacos are everywhere. Look for smaller, family-run establishments for the most authentic (and budget-friendly) experiences.

    * **Where to Find Them:** Often, the best taco shops are in less touristy neighborhoods. Ask locals for their recommendations.
    * **What to Order:** Carne asada, fish tacos, and adobada are classic choices. Don’t be afraid to try less common options like lengua (tongue) for a more adventurous bite.
    * **Budget Tip:** Street tacos are typically the cheapest, often costing just a few dollars each.

    Pho: A Warm and Filling Option

    Pho, the Vietnamese noodle soup, is another great cheap eat. It’s filling, flavorful, and often comes in large portions, perfect for a satisfying meal.

    * **Where to Find Them:** Head to the Convoy District for a plethora of Vietnamese restaurants offering pho.
    * **What to Order:** Pho Tai (rare steak) and Pho Ga (chicken) are popular choices. Experiment with different broths and toppings to find your favorite.
    * **Budget Tip:** Pho restaurants often have lunch specials that offer even greater value.

    Burritos: California-Style Comfort Food

    California burritos, typically stuffed with carne asada, french fries, cheese, and guacamole, are a San Diego institution and a great budget option.

    * **Where to Find Them:** Numerous Mexican restaurants and taquerias throughout the city serve California burritos.
    * **What to Order:** The California burrito is the obvious choice, but don’t overlook other burrito variations, such as the surf and turf (with shrimp and steak).
    * **Budget Tip:** Share a burrito with a friend, as they are often quite large.

  • does it snow in san diego

    Does It Snow in San Diego? The Truth About San Diego Snowfall

    While San Diego is known for its sunny beaches and mild climate, the question of whether it snows there occasionally surfaces. The answer is yes, but snowfall in San Diego is a rare and usually light event, primarily occurring in the higher mountain regions of the county.

    Where Does Snow Fall in San Diego?

    Snowfall in San Diego is almost exclusively limited to the mountainous areas of East County. Locations like Julian, Mount Laguna, and Palomar Mountain are the most likely to experience snowfall. These areas, with elevations exceeding 4,000 feet, see temperatures low enough to support snow during winter storms. Even in these regions, significant snowfall is infrequent, occurring a few times per year at most.

    What About Snowfall Near the Coast?

    Snowfall along San Diego’s coastline is exceptionally rare. Temperatures near the coast are generally too warm for snow to form, even during the coldest winter months. On the rare occasions that temperatures drop significantly, sleet or a very light dusting of snow may occur, but it typically melts quickly. Such events are considered anomalies and generate considerable local buzz.

    Historical Snowfall in San Diego

    Historical records confirm the rarity of snowfall in coastal San Diego. While heavier snowfalls have occurred in the mountains, reaching depths of several feet during particularly strong winter storms, coastal areas have only experienced measurable snowfall a handful of times in the past century. More details can be found on San Diego’s climate page.

    Factors Influencing Snowfall

    Several factors contribute to the infrequent snowfall in San Diego. The region’s proximity to the Pacific Ocean moderates temperatures, preventing them from dropping too low. Additionally, the mountains to the east act as a barrier, trapping much of the moisture and cold air that would otherwise reach the coastal areas. Large scale weather patterns like El Nino and La Nina can also influence the severity and frequency of winter storms that bring snow to the mountains.

    What is Permanent Jewelry?

    Permanent jewelry isn’t actually “permanent” in the strictest sense, but it’s designed to be worn continuously for an extended period. A small jump ring is welded closed, creating a secure, clasp-free design. The process is quick, painless, and completely customizable, letting you choose your chain and any charms or embellishments you want to add.

    The Welding Process

    The welding process involves using a specialized machine to create a small, precise weld that fuses the two ends of the chain together. Jewelers who offer this service are trained in safety and precision to ensure a comfortable and secure fit. The process is quick, typically taking only a few minutes. It is important to know that the weld can be easily snipped with household scissors if the need arises, making it anything but permanent.
